Responsibilities

Accountabilities & Responsibilities

  • Create daily and weekly machine production schedules based on operational needs and priorities
  • Collaborate with the Plant Manager and Superintendent to track production progress and address issues
  • Compile and maintain production records to perform data analysis and drive process improvements
  • Communicate with customers and sales teams regarding pricing, lead times, and order status
  • Work closely with production leads to maintain workflow efficiency
  • Partner with production and management to ensure any concerns related to production flow are addressed
  • Serves as a liaison with customers, sales, manufacturing and upper management to ensure timely production flows
  • Monitor product quality and ensure any concerns are addressed
  • Assist with inventory counts, to include reconciling discrepancies
  • Support inbound and outbound logistics, including paperwork, truck coordination, communication with drivers and staff, and other related duties
  • Monitor inventory of facility consumable supplies and reorder as needed
  • Create purchase orders and maintain accurate inventory and purchasing records
  • Answer incoming phone calls and assist visitors, as needed
  • Support the Plant Manager with special projects and process improvements
